Mosquito Forecast for Lüübnitsa

If you're planning a visit to Lüübnitsa, understanding the local mosquito forecast is essential for a comfortable stay. The Lüübnitsa mosquito forecast predicts peak mosquito activity during the summer months, especially in July when the count reaches 9 out of 10. The village, nestled near Lake Pihkva, offers lush wetlands that create ideal breeding grounds for mosquitoes. Early spring and late autumn see much lower activity, with January and February typically at a minimal level of 1. What Influences Mosquito Activity in Lüübnitsa?

Several factors influence mosquito populations in Lüübnitsa. The region's humid climate and proximity to water bodies like Lake Pihkva provide perfect conditions for mosquito breeding. Warmer temperatures accelerate their life cycle, increasing numbers during summer. Additionally, the area's dense forests and marshlands offer shelter and food sources. Key influences include: - Temperature and humidity levels - Availability of stagnant water - Seasonal vegetation changes Understanding these helps locals and visitors anticipate mosquito presence. Mosquito-Borne Diseases in the Lüübnitsa Area

While Lüübnitsa's mosquitoes are mostly a nuisance, there is a low but notable risk of mosquito-borne diseases such as the Tahyna virus and, rarely, West Nile virus. These infections are uncommon but can cause flu-like symptoms. Preventive measures are crucial, especially during peak mosquito season. The local health department recommends: 1. Using insect repellents containing DEET or picaridin. 2. Wearing long sleeves and pants during dawn and dusk. 3. Ensuring window screens are intact.
